摘要 <P>PROBLEM TO BE SOLVED: To provide polycrystalline nanodiamond utilizable to magnetic sensing, and to provide a production method thereof. <P>SOLUTION: This polycrystalline nanodiamond 1 is composed of carbon with &ge;99.9 mass% purity of<SP POS="POST">12</SP>C carbon isotope, and a plurality of impurities other than carbon, where the concentration of the plurality of impurities is each 0.01 mass% or less, and the crystal grain diameter is 500 nm or less. This polycrystalline nanodiamond 1 has &ge;99.9 mass% purity of<SP POS="POST">12</SP>C carbon isotope, and can be produced by pyrolyzing hydrocarbon gas with &ge;99 mass% chemical purity to obtain graphite, and applying heat treatment to the obtained graphite in a high temperature, high pressure press machine to convert the graphite into diamond. <P>COPYRIGHT: (C)2013,JPO&INPIT
